精易论坛

标题: 求大佬们一个键盘映射手柄的源码,最好可以自定义... [打印本页]

作者: litiechui    时间: 2023-11-9 17:12
标题: 求大佬们一个键盘映射手柄的源码,最好可以自定义...
官网有xinput的api接口,网站如下XINPUT_KEYSTROKE (xinput.h) - Win32 apps | Microsoft Learn
用的xinput的api接口,之前看到有大神发源码可以实现手柄监测,用的XInputGetState
想问有没有大神可以弄一个可以重映射到键盘并且可以自定义键位那种,比如定义一个键可以让他左摇杆左上15度往前一直走这种,市面上各种的手柄映射的软件都只能直着往前后左右
或者就是左45度往前走,没办法自定义左摇杆,有大神可以弄一个左右摇杆自定义按键的程序吗
我实在不会用易语言直接调用api,初学者一个。。。

最终目的是想用易语言定义个一键连招,只要可以模拟手柄就行,不一定非要键盘重映射哪个按键,比如代码可以直接模拟手柄也行非常感谢大佬!!
大佬辛苦了!!!


作者: xdj123    时间: 2023-11-9 17:27
理论上应该可以

作者: xdj123    时间: 2023-11-9 17:28
你首先把接口做成易语言,剩下就是自己写逻辑

作者: 7ian    时间: 2023-11-9 18:27
可以试试,之前获取郭,用XInputGetState可以获取,绑定就用set
作者: litiechui    时间: 2023-11-9 18:31
xdj123 发表于 2023-11-9 17:28
你首先把接口做成易语言,剩下就是自己写逻辑

关键就是不会。。。我萌新只会抄作业233
作者: litiechui    时间: 2023-11-9 18:32
7ian 发表于 2023-11-9 18:27
可以试试,之前获取郭,用XInputGetState可以获取,绑定就用set

可以实现模拟手柄就和模拟键盘一样是吗
作者: litiechui    时间: 2023-11-9 18:50
xdj123 发表于 2023-11-9 17:27
理论上应该可以

你可以做吗大佬有偿
作者: sihuyc    时间: 2023-11-9 21:41
我看看 能不能帮你编译出DLL  剩下的你自己调用dll了
作者: 新手小岑    时间: 2023-12-11 00:39
sihuyc 发表于 2023-11-9 21:41
我看看 能不能帮你编译出DLL  剩下的你自己调用dll了

咋样了? 我也很需要
作者: 妄语    时间: 2025-3-6 21:19
学习一下学习一下学习一下学习一下学习一下学习一下学习一下学习一下




欢迎光临 精易论坛 (https://125.confly.eu.org/) Powered by Discuz! X3.4